One single minute. Yup, just 60 seconds. That’s all the time it takes to get to the beach from the splendid setting of Surfer's Paradise Campsite, on a green meadow a teeny distance from the coast in the Devon village of Croyde. Croyde is, of course, rightly famed as a surfing hotspot, so before you dash straight off to the beach (as enticing as its sands may be), you’d do well to wriggle into a wetsuit and grab a board for hitting the waves. Those who are new to all this can hire kit from the surf shop on site and find plenty of experts locally for a lesson or few. Not in the mood to encase yourself in neoprene? The sands are equally excellent for beach volleyball, sea-view walks, picnics or just a bit of chilling out, and there are umpteen visitor attractions nearby, including a dinosaur park, an animal park, an aquarium and sheep racing (but of course). Picnic tables are scattered around the site for those who’d like to do seaside self-catering, or it’s a 10-minute stroll to the village centre for pubs, restaurants and cafés. Toilets and hot showers are on site and guests are also welcome to use the facilities at the site’s larger sister park, a couple of minutes away on foot – a games arcade, soft play area, fishing pond and indoor pool with waterslide await over there.

Local attractions

Croyde’s an excellent beach, there’s no arguing with that (and home to some of the finest surfing this side of the pond) but it’s worth getting out to other corners of this coastline, as there are numerous gems to take in. Board riders may also like to take to the waves at Saunton Sands (10 minutes’ drive) while those in search of a little land-based time can scramble in the dunes at Braunton Burrows (20 minutes) or wander on the coast path to Baggy Point and beyond. Family-friendly seaside days can be had up in Ilfracombe (25 minutes), where you can scamper underground to Tunnels Beaches, come face to face with fish life at the aquarium and board sea safaris in search of wildlife out in the waves. Other options locally include the animated dinos and real-life beasts at Combe Martin Wildlife & Dinosaur Park (35 minutes) and steam-powered outings on the Lynton & Barnstaple Railway (45 minutes). And that sheep racing? (Go on, you know you want to…) That’s at the Big Sheep amusement park (40 minutes), also home to a big indoor playground, a collection of rides and a brewery and gin distillery to perk up the grownups.

Water quality at nearby bathing waters

Name Distance Type 2020 2019 2018 2017
Croyde Bay 0.2 mi Sea N/A Good Excellent Good
Putsborough 1.1 mi Sea N/A Excellent Excellent Excellent
Saunton Sands 1.3 mi Sea N/A Excellent Excellent Excellent
Woolacombe Village 2.8 mi Sea N/A Excellent Excellent Excellent
Combesgate Beach, Woolacombe 3.2 mi Sea N/A Excellent Excellent Excellent

Data source: European Environment Agency
